### Changelog — Harrowgate Metrics Sidecar v2.8

This release changes several defaults for the harrow-agg sidecar based on incidents reviewed at the last two eng syncs. The flush interval is now shorter to reduce data loss during pod evictions, the in-memory buffer cap is larger to absorb scrape bursts, and gzip forwarding is enabled by default. Operators who previously overrode these values should confirm their overrides still apply, since the precedence order also changed. The full set of new defaults is reproduced below.

deployment values, faduf-tawep:
SORDOR_LOG_LEVEL=error
SORDOR_METRICS_HOST=metrics.sordor.nelvrolabs.internal
SORDOR_POOL_SIZE=4

ScrubPix releases are cut monthly from the `stable` branch. Each release bundles the EXIF scrubbing engine, updated camera-model tables, and the redaction presets used by the Fernvale support tooling. Support staff should direct customers to the latest tagged build, since older versions may miss newer metadata fields. Release archives are published alongside checksums and a detached signature. Before sharing a build with a customer, verify the archive against the signature using the current release signing key, which is provided below.

signing key of kahog-kadup = bky13_6wLyxnPsJob4P

Runbook: PixelRinse EXIF Scrubber — Onboarding Notes. New hires: PixelRinse strips location and device metadata from every upload before it reaches the Corvane asset store. If scrubbed images stop appearing, check the queue consumer first; it refuses to start without credentials for the metadata vault. Open /opt/pixelrinse/scrub.env in your editor, confirm QUEUE_REGION is set to "dornmere-2", and then append the vault access key on the following line.

env line for yahip-tafog: RELAY_SECRET3=4ca

# Artifact Signing — Monthly Partitioned Tables

The Quillstone warehouse partitions its artifact-audit tables by calendar month. Each partition is sealed at month end, hashed, and signed before archival so reviewers can verify no rows were altered retroactively. Reviewers should confirm the partition boundary timestamps match the manifest before approving a seal. All seals for the current cycle must be produced with the key below.

deploy key for kajof-fajop: bky6_gDHw9Q